In the matter of Green Alliance Pty Limited (receiver and manager appointed) [2012] NSWSC 1224

Jurisdiction
Australia
Judgment Date
30 August 2012
Procedural Posture
Interlocutory Application for Strike Out of Defence and Summary Judgment / Application by Plaintiff Filed 4 July 2012 Heard on 30 August 2012; Ex Tempore Judgment
Outcome
Third Defendant's Defence struck out; judgment for Plaintiff with damages to be assessed; matter referred to an Associate Justice for determination of damages; Third Defendant ordered to pay Plaintiff's costs of the summary judgment application forthwith as agreed or assessed.

  1. 1 ["Whether the Third Defendant's Defence should be struck out because it disclosed no reasonable defence or had a tendency to cause prejudice, embarrassment or delay." 'Whether summary judgment should be entered for the Plaintiff under UCPR r 13.1 with damages to be assessed.' "Whether the pleaded agreement involving a third party, estoppel or waiver gave Green Alliance a real prospect of defending the Plaintiff's claim." 'Whether Green Alliance should be granted leave to amend its Defence.']

Ratio Decidendi

Green Alliance had no real prospect of successfully defending the proceedings on the Defence as pleaded and the evidence relied on. The alleged agreement with Cold Water Creek did not plead or establish a release of Green Alliance from its Lease obligations, and the estoppel and waiver defences lacked specific pleaded representations, reliance and detriment. The further arguments advanced orally were not pleaded and were not supported by evidence. Given the age of the proceedings, the time since the summary judgment application was filed, the absence of any attempt to amend, and the likely prejudice and delay to MDM, leave to amend was refused.
